Bora rear fogs by Dave
In case anyone wants two rear foglights on their Bora, Golf etc I found that the wiring was all there on our 99 V5. The only thing missing was the bulb! However on checking our 2001 Lupo, the necessary wire is missing so if I want two rear fogs on that I'll have to take a feed from the RHS fog light. Otherwise everything is in place. Cheers Dave
